Two Bangladeshi Muslims, looted an ISKCON  temple in  in Sewaram Gangwar, Kharghar in January and seized Rs 80,000 in cash and stole the idols. The perpetrators have been identified as 26 year old, Farhat Sheikh, alias Raju and  23 year old, Akash Mannan  Khan alias Amirul.

Navi Mumbai Police Commissioner, Bipin Kumar Singh said three cash boxes, some cash and idols were stolen from the ISKCON temple in Kharghar on January 31, 2022.

The police seized Rs 80,000 in cash and the stolen idols. They had illegally entered India  from Bangladesh through the West Bengal border with the help of an agent, the police said. It was initially reported that Rs 1.5 lakhs had been stolen from the temple, so Rs. 70,000 still remains to be found.

The police further added that Cases of temple theft and house breaking have been registered against the duo in Mumbai and also Ahmedabad and they were arrested in some of them earlier.
